February highlighted the?release of a pair of dried yeast strains: Mango Madness and High Voltage. They are both thermotolerant yeast strains, meaning they operate at much higher temperatures than normal brewing yeast strains. What’s more, neither of them produce any off flavors associated with higher temperature fermentation.
Thermotolerant yeast strains have been implemented in the distilling industry for a number of years because of their increased fermentation kinetics and the reduction of energy consumption. Thermotolerant yeast strains improve fermentation speed and decrease the conditioning period, meaning the overall tank time in the brewery is significantly reduced. Therefore, increasing productivity over the course of the year while decreasing production costs such as chilling.

High Voltage, Electrifyingly Clean Thermotolerant Yeast
High Voltage is designed for brewers aiming for a clean-tasting beer across a variety of styles, from Lager, West Coast IPAs, Stouts, and Red Ales. Its optimal operating temperature is in the 30-35°C range. It offers the potential to experiment with cooler fermentations for an even cleaner profile. Our trials show that using this thermotolerant yeast reduces fermentation and conditioning times by an average of 30% compared to clean ale yeast strains such as LAX, and well over 50% compared to traditional lager yeast fermentations.
Mango Madness, Thermotolerant IPA Yeast
On the other end of the flavour spectrum is Mango Madness, the counter opposite of High Voltage in that, it is used in styles that call for a more expressive yeast strain and high levels of biotransformation. It is particularly good for NEIPA style beers, or any beers with a high hop charge. The thermotolerant yeast excels in the 30C temp range and has a high haze stability. It also allows dry hopping at higher temperatures. Its perfect for both standard and high gravity brewing as the fermentation time is severely reduced. A recent trial brew in a local brewery that was producing a 1.080 gravity DIPA, in which they would normally use our Saturated yeast, the fermentation time was reduced by 50%. The full fermentation was completed in less 72 hours, with a lower pitch rate than normally used.?The thermotolerant yeast also allows dry hopping at higher temperatures.
